Small pistols can present big problems under stress reloads. On top of limited magazine capacity, undersized controls can hamper-or even prevent-a proper reload. The stakes are clear in that event. Don't run the risk….install a Vickers Tactical Slide Stop. It features the same positive V-shape with deep serrations that enables fast manipulation, in both directions, found on the original VT Slide Stop. A huge improvement to the Glock®42 and 43. Fits Glock®Model 42 and 43. Will not fit Glock®Models 25 or 28. Reshaped thumb pad with deep serrations, allows easy slide lock and release, even with gloves. Precision stamped from 4130 chrome moly steel, with non-glare black finish.

Great for Glock Slin Frames...
I have these slide stops on my G43 and G43X. Even on these slim frame pistols, I find the factory stops too flat against the frame to manipulate comfortably. The Vickers part allows easier access without getting in the way.

Great piece for Small Frame GLOCK
Have one on my Glock 42 and now G43, its great for the small frame Glocks! The angle and slight rounded bulge of the release allow for a good purchase to manipulate the slide stop but it's not over sized such that you'll hit it with your thumb while firing and either lock it back or release it inadvertently--very important, and the part aesthetically looks like a Glock factory slide stop! 2
It works...but I have issues.
This is a well made slide release. It is much easier to manipulate and is just the right size for my thumb. It was easy to install and the overall quality is good. So on the reason why I bought this item. I know that it is advertised as a slide stop, but lets be honest, it's a slide release. To my knowledge glock teaches that their pistols use a slide stop. Meaning that racking the slide during a slide lock reload is the "correct way" to complete that type of reload with the factory slide stop. The factory slide stop is just that, a slide stop. It is not intended to be used as a release. Hence the upgrade to this product. This product allows a much easier reload from slide lock. Also manually locking the slide is much easier as well. Now this may just be a defect, but the one I received caused failures to feed. This product does not lock the slide far enough back to perform a slide lock reload from partially loaded magazines(3 or less rounds). Is that really a big deal? Maybe. The way I see it, it makes a pretty big "what if" case. If for what ever reason I had to load a partially loaded magazine from slide lock in a fight and I used this slide release, it would jam. Could I just remember to rack the slide? Maybe. The point is that it takes a lot of confidence out of the firearm. I need to know that when I load a mag of whatever capacity it is at and I hit the slide stop or rack the slide its going to feed. For me, that's with the factory part.
